KS66 ARA is a 2017 Vauxhall Adam in Black with a 1,229c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70%.
Across all 2017 Vauxhall Adam models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.5% with a typical mileage of 33,654 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The Vauxhall Adam typically stays on UK roads for around 13 years. At 9 years old, this Vauxhall Adam is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
